Manchester United set to beat Premier League rivals to Lille's Nicolas Pepe

The 24-year-old was one of the standout players of the 2018/19 Ligue 1 season, scoring 22 goals to help his side to a surprise second-place finish. According to the Mirror, the Ivory Coast international is a target for United if Lukaku leaves, with Inter Milan desperate to sign the Belgian striker this summer. The Serie A side have so far failed with their efforts to secure Lukaku’s signature but are continuing their pursuit. Pepe would consider a move to Old Trafford, but Premier League sides like Arsenal and Liverpool have also expressed interest.
